2019 Company Review:
• Headquarters at Saint Vincent de Mercuze, France
• 7 sales subsidiaries: France, England, Germany, United States, China, Spain (Top30) and Norway
• 5 production sites: Spain (ISO9001 certified), England, China, New Zealand and the United States
• A distributor network in more than 30 countries
• Company’s investments include the subsidiary, Clip’n Climb Plymouth Limited
What is the prospect’s strategy and ambitions?
Strategy
• The principal activity of the group in the year under review (2018) was that of the construction of the design and manufacture of the climbing structures, as well as the running of a climbing centre in Plymouth.
• As a partner to the IFSC (International Federation of Sport Climbing), EP is committed to playing an active role in developing climbing for all and has been the proud exclusive provider of the very first Olympic climbing Walls at the Youth Olympic Games in Buenos Aires 2018.
• Partnering many national federations: BMC, BCA, FEDME, CMA, USA Climbing
• 2015 Acquisition of 50 % of the New Zealand company Clip ’n Climb International
• 2016 Monkey Space: a modular, innovative training concept

What are the prospect’s unique selling points (USPs)?
- Pioneer in the climbing wall industry, designing, manufacturing and installing bespoke solutions for the sport of climbing throughout the world.
- As a multi-specialist, EP is active in a variety of markets, including local authorities, clubs and federations, professional groups and private investors
- Providing customisable services available include artificial climbing structures, holds and accessories together with maintenance, training and route-setting services
- Official partner to the International Federation of Sport Climbing (IFSC)
- Providing products of high quality – produced on an ISO9001- certified site, and have limited environmental impact through the use of FSC- certified wood panels
- Their team consists of highly qualified manufacturers and installers, trained in safety inspections
- All design and installation processes are carried out in strict accordance with current safety standards EN 12572
- Giving comprehensive support for customers with their projects
